    Migom money transfer system – more than 17400 points of cashout!


    OKPAY Company has joined Migom - international money transfer system network. As of today Migom is available in 17 countries and 4150 cities (more than 17400 representative offices).

    Migom system allows transfers without banking details, total commission is 2-3% of the transferred amount (receiver is not paying any commission). You only need a valid identification document to send/receive money. One of the features is that a client can accept a transfer in any representative office.

    What is Ukash voucher?

    Ukash voucher is electronic money. It enables you to exchange your physical money for a voucher code which represents electronic money of the same value. Your Ukash value is not held centrally in an account that is linked to your identity; instead, the voucher value is linked to the voucher code. Put simply, anyone who knows the voucher code and the value can spend that value online.

    OKPAY trademark registered in the European Union
    OKPAY received a registered European Community Trade Mark from Office for Harmonization in the Internal Market (Trade Marks & Designs) – OHIM for the company’s OKPAY brand. The January 2nd, 2012 issuance of OHIM serial number 010083764 grants OKPAY exclusive Europe-wide rights to use the mark on or in connection with electronic wallet services, credit card transactions, and other financial operations, all our services worldwide will be presented under the registered service mark OKPAY.
